The first part of the walk is along a ridge which gives views over Cheshire, Manchester and the Peak District. On a clear day you might see Mam Tor to the east and the Welsh hills to the west.

Leaving the ridge takes you into a quiet valley with no roads. It is wonderfully peaceful, but can be muddy in wet weather. Remember to look back up the valley as you travel down it. The view can be spectacular. Also watch out for birds and the occasional wild animal.

Lovely, easy to navigate, walk with beautiful views. I suspect it will be busy on weekends. It was quite boggy in parts despite recent heat wave so be prepared for wet feet. As I've discovered all over this area, dogs have to be kept on lead April to July because of ground-nesting birds
